What You'll Do
Â
As an Inside Sales Representative, you'll work directly with customers as well as our CAD, purchasing and production teams to:
Â
- Respond to customer requests for quotes and orders
- Review customer drawings, specifications, dimensions and material requirements
- Prepare accurate quotes for metal products, processing and fabricated parts
- Help customers identify material and processing solutions for their projects
- Communicate pricing, inventory availability and lead times
- Convert approved quotes into accurate sales orders for production
- Coordinate customer requirements with purchasing, production, quality, shipping and outside processors
- Follow up on quotes and orders while identifying opportunities to grow customer accounts
- Build strong customer relationships and help resolve questions or issues throughout the order process
- Manage order revisions and changing customer requirements
Â
You'll be managing multiple RFQs and customer orders at the same time, so organization, accuracy, and communication are important.

About Specialty Metals Corporation
Â
Specialty Metals Corporation is a locally operated metal distributor, processor and fabrication company located in Kent, Washington. Since 1981, we've grown from supplying metal into a company capable of helping customers with everything from raw material to completed fabricated parts.
Â
Our goal is simple: make it easier for our customers to get what they need from one supplier.
